Add 9/14 and 75/7
1st number: 9/14, 2nd number: 10 5/7
9/14 + 75/7 is 159/14.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 14 and 7 is 14
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 14 - For the 1st fraction, since 14 × 1 = 14,
9/14 = 9 × 1/14 × 1 = 9/14 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 7 × 2 = 14,
75/7 = 75 × 2/7 × 2 = 150/14 - Add the two like fractions:
9/14 + 150/14 = 9 + 150/14 = 159/14 - So, 9/14 + 75/7 = 159/14
In mixed form: 115/14
